The two most commonly used spray foam products are low-density,
open-cell SPF (nominally referred to as “1/2 pound”) and
medium-density, closed-cell foam (“2 pound”). Foametix offers both
types of SPF, dubbed Blue Max 050 Open-cell and Blue Max 200
Closed-cell.
